Any app or method to create a hotspot instead of an adhoc network on the N900? Or is this not possible due to hardware limitations?

I believe that its a driver limitation,
I think what you are looking for is a way to set the wireless card to master mode which I don't think is possible atm.

Yes but it also creates an adhoc connection. This is something that Apple had the foresight to enable on their wifi drivers.

I don't believe the N900 is capable of broadcasting a wifi signal any other way than as an adhoc one.
